White Sectional Sofa Elevates Your Living Room
A white sectional sofa can elevate your living space. If you're hosting a movie night or a family gathering you can comfortably seat your friends and loved ones with ease.
These are also pet- and child-friendly. They're made of stain-resistant performance fabrics such as twill or microfiber. There are a range of customizable options.
1. Comfort
A white sectional sofa is a great choice for those who like to spread out and unwinding. These big couches typically have more seating options than regular sofas, making them the perfect choice for large families or people who enjoy hosting large gatherings. The most comfortable sectional sofas are made of an array of high-resiliency foam padding, feathers made of duck down and other durable fabrics that feel luxurious and soft when you sit down on them. It is also advisable to search for sofas that have removable pillow covers that are easy to clean.
When shopping for a new white sectional, consider the way you'll use the couch and who will be using it. For instance, if prefer to host informal gatherings, opt for modular designs that allow you to easily arrange the pieces to suit your space. If you are a fan of recline then you should consider a sofa with powered recliners with built-in USB chargers and adjustable headrests that raise or lower to increase the comfort.
The frame material and the upholstery are equally important. It is recommended to use kiln dried wood for the frame that will resist warping and bending with time. The upholstery should be simple to keep clean and robust enough to withstand regular use and cleaning, including stains from kids and pets. A reversible chaise sectional, like the Albany Park Kova, is an alternative for living rooms that are subject to lots of activity.
Remember that most sectionals offer chaise lounges that rotate from both sides. This gives you more seating options. Depending on the way you'll be using your sofa, you may want the left-facing chaise or right-facing one. Another thing to consider when buying a sectional is the amount of space you have in your living room. If you're working with an area that is small, a sectional could take up too much space and obstruct other furniture. In this situation you may prefer a regular sofa.

4. Space-Saving
Sectionals are versatile, allowing you to adjust your seating capacity to match your needs and space. For instance L-shaped sectionals work great in smaller rooms and open floor plans. You can open the back to facilitate rearranging, or close it and use the corners for other furniture. These configurations increase seating capacity and take up less space than multiple sofas. Many sectionals with upholstered seating come with removable and reversible cushion covers, making cleanup simple.
This white leather sectional sofa from Pottery Barn is a great choice if you like a relaxed vibe. It has a timeless design that's sure to stand the test of time. Combine it with a coffee table made of burlwood and modern accents to channel an edgier style.
A U-shaped sectional like this one from Article can create a warm and inviting space for family gatherings. It's a great option for large spaces since everyone can sit in front of each other to have a conversation. The rounded design of this couch also pairs well with the round coffee table.
It is important to add other textures to the room to avoid it looking too bland. Include a woven carpet wallpaper or patterned curtains to your living space to add visual interest and warmth.
Murphy says that while it is possible to place an ordinary sofa in the middle a room, she recommends using a sectional to give more space behind the sofa to walk and access your door. Murphy suggests this technique can be particularly beneficial for smaller spaces that could feel boxed in with other furniture items.
